lime crema recipe Ingredients
- 1 cup sour cream – This creamy base adds richness and tang, making it the perfect canvas for your lime crema.
- 1 tablespoon lime juice (freshly squeezed) – Fresh lime juice brightens up the flavor, providing a zesty kick that complements any dish.
- 1 teaspoon lime zest (fresh) – Grated from the outer peel, lime zest enhances the citrus aroma and adds depth to the taste.
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der – This adds a subtle savory note that balances the creaminess and elevates the overall flavor profile.
- 1 teaspoon salt (to taste) – A pinch of salt enhances all the flavors; adjust according to your preference for a perfect lime crema recipe.
How to Make lime crema recipe
1. Combine ingredients: In a mixing bowl, combine 1 cup of sour cream, 1 tablespoon of freshly squeezed lime juice, 1 teaspoon of fresh lime zest, 1 teaspoon of garlic powder, and 1 teaspoon of salt.
2. Whisk together: Using a whisk, blend the mixture until it's smooth and well combined. Aim for a creamy texture that’s both zesty and inviting.
3. Taste and adjust: Finally, take a moment to taste your lime crema. Adjust the seasoning with more salt or lime juice if needed to suit your palate.
Optional: Drizzle with extra lime zest for a beautiful garnish!

Tips for the Best lime crema recipe
- Fresh Ingredients: Use freshly squeezed lime juice and zest for the best flavor. Bottled lime juice can taste flat and lack the vibrant zing you want.
- Taste as You Go: After mixing, always taste your lime crema recipe. Adjust the salt or add a pinch more lime juice for extra brightness if needed.
- Consistency Matters: For a thinner drizzle, add a bit more lime juice or a splash of water. If it's too runny, mix in a touch more sour cream.
- Storage Tips: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ge. Consume within 3 days for optimal freshness and flavor.
- Avoid Overmixing: Whisk just until smooth; overmixing can make the crema too runny and affect its creamy texture.

lime crema recipe Your Way
Feel free to get creative and make this sauce your own with these delightful twists!
- Spicy Kick: Add 1 teaspoon of chipotle powder for a smoky, spicy flavor. This variation is perfect for those who love heat. It adds depth and warmth, making each drizzle even more exciting!
- Herb Infusion: Stir in 1 tablespoon of finely chopped cilantro or parsley for a fresh herbal note. This addition not only brightens the flavor but also gives a beautiful pop of color. It’s like bringing a garden party to your plate!
- Avocado Cream: Replace half of the sour cream with mashed avocado for a creamy, dreamy texture. The avocado lends a rich mouthfeel and an earthy taste that pairs beautifully with lime. It’s perfect for those who want an extra layer of richness.
- Coconut Flair: Swap sour cream with coconut yogurt for a dairy-free option with a subtle coconut sweetness. This twist creates a tropical vibe that complements grilled chicken or shrimp beautifully. It’s an invitation to escape to sunny shores with every bite.
- Zesty Garlic: Increase garlic powder to 2 teaspoons for robust flavor lovers. The added garlic makes the crema irresistibly savory. It’s great on tacos or as a dip with crunchy veggies!
- Cumin Spice: Add ½ teaspoon ground cumin for an earthy, warm undertone. This spice transforms the crema into something uniquely flavorful, perfect for pairing with grilled meats or roasted vegetables.
- Lime & Orange: Mix in 1 tablespoon of freshly squeezed orange juice alongside the lime juice for a citrusy twist. This combination brightens up the sauce, adding sweetness that elevates your dishes beautifully.
- Creamy Cashew: Blend soaked cashews with other ingredients instead of sour cream for a nutty alternative. This swap creates an indulgent texture while keeping it dairy-free. It’s perfect for drizzling over salads or tacos!

lime crema recipe Questions Answered
What type of sour cream is best for this lime crema recipe?
For a rich and creamy texture, I recommend using full-fat sour cream. It provides the perfect base for our zesty lime crema, giving it a luscious mouthfeel that complements tacos and grilled meats beautifully. If you're looking for a lighter option, you can use reduced-fat sour cream, but keep in mind that it may alter the overall creaminess.
Can I substitute lime juice with other citrus juices?
Absolutely! While this lime crema recipe shines with freshly squeezed lime juice, you can experiment with lemon or even orange juice for a different flavor twist. Just remember to adjust the amount of zest accordingly since lemons and oranges have different intensities. A tablespoon of fresh lemon juice can add a lovely brightness as well!
How should I store leftover lime crema?
To keep your lime crema fresh, transfer it to an airtight container and refrigerate. It will stay good for about 3 to 5 days. Just give it a quick stir before serving again, as some separation may occur during storage. If you notice any off smells or changes in color, it's best to discard it.
Can I freeze lime crema?
While it's possible to freeze lime crema, the texture may change upon thawing—resulting in a slightly grainy consistency. If you're okay with that, just pour it into a freezer-safe container and consume within 1-2 months. When you're ready to use it, thaw it in the refrigerator overnight and re-whisk before serving.
What if my lime crema is too salty?
If you find your lime crema too salty after mixing, don’t panic! You can balance out the saltiness by adding more sour cream (about ¼ cup) or some additional lime juice to brighten up the flavors without overwhelming the dish. Just mix thoroughly and taste again until you achieve your desired seasoning.
